diff options
author | Liang Qi <liang.qi@qt.io> | 2019-04-24 10:52:39 +0200 |
---|---|---|
committer | Liang Qi <liang.qi@qt.io> | 2019-04-24 11:55:36 +0200 |
commit | 4399a1683a016794e22ecdd03eafca07b93af4e2 (patch) | |
tree | d1a4da3ad9a57d60da2c7c71ae03a13701c67f16 /src/qtattributionsscanner | |
parent | d91ecc26252f42641a23e25f6a6a18495e0e7700 (diff) | |
parent | 97075ce49ee73609330804b8bbbc12fabbb30766 (diff) |
Merge remote-tracking branch 'origin/5.12' into 5.13
Conflicts:
.qmake.conf
src/qdoc/qmlmarkupvisitor.h
src/qdoc/qmlvisitor.h
tests/auto/qtattributionsscanner/testdata/good/expected.json
Done-With: Kai Koehne <kai.koehne@qt.io>
Change-Id: I180ee214d1e5999fc1279b092bd9214b6bf8f858
Diffstat (limited to 'src/qtattributionsscanner')
-rw-r--r-- | src/qtattributionsscanner/jsongenerator.cpp | 1 | ||||
-rw-r--r-- | src/qtattributionsscanner/package.h | 2 | ||||
-rw-r--r-- | src/qtattributionsscanner/scanner.cpp | 2 |
3 files changed, 5 insertions, 0 deletions
diff --git a/src/qtattributionsscanner/jsongenerator.cpp b/src/qtattributionsscanner/jsongenerator.cpp index 37d0426af..44fb784aa 100644 --- a/src/qtattributionsscanner/jsongenerator.cpp +++ b/src/qtattributionsscanner/jsongenerator.cpp @@ -58,6 +58,7 @@ static QJsonObject generate(Package package) obj.insert(QStringLiteral("LicenseFile"), package.licenseFile); obj.insert(QStringLiteral("Copyright"), package.copyright); + obj.insert(QStringLiteral("PackageComment"), package.packageComment); return obj; } diff --git a/src/qtattributionsscanner/package.h b/src/qtattributionsscanner/package.h index a0cb82fdd..4a8a9e3e2 100644 --- a/src/qtattributionsscanner/package.h +++ b/src/qtattributionsscanner/package.h @@ -53,6 +53,8 @@ struct Package { QString licenseFile; // path to file containing the license text. Optional. QString copyright; // A list of copyright owners. Mandatory. + + QString packageComment; // Further comments about the package. Optional. }; #endif // PACKAGE_H diff --git a/src/qtattributionsscanner/scanner.cpp b/src/qtattributionsscanner/scanner.cpp index a6c38a3f0..dc7b88fbf 100644 --- a/src/qtattributionsscanner/scanner.cpp +++ b/src/qtattributionsscanner/scanner.cpp @@ -120,6 +120,8 @@ static Package readPackage(const QJsonObject &object, const QString &filePath, L p.licenseFile = QDir(directory).absoluteFilePath(value); } else if (key == QLatin1String("Copyright")) { p.copyright = value; + } else if (key == QLatin1String("PackageComment")) { + p.packageComment = value; } else if (key == QLatin1String("QDocModule")) { p.qdocModule = value; } else if (key == QLatin1String("Description")) { |